Walk to Everything. Come Home to Privacy. 513 Croslin Street #B | Highland | Austin Live where everything clicks. Steps from some of Austin's best coffee shops, local dining, parks, and public transit, this Highland gem puts the best of Central Austin at your fingertips, while keeping you in one of the neighborhood's most centrally located communities. One of only four residences, this Fazio-designed two-story home built in 2016 checks every box for the buyer who wants smart design, low-maintenance living, and a location that actually works. At 1,036 sq ft, the layout is efficient without feeling small; high ceilings and windows throughout keep the home light-filled and open. The main floor flows seamlessly from the living room into the kitchen, where you'll find a center island with quartz countertops, custom cabinetry, pantry, subway tile, and stainless steel appliances. Hand-scraped wood flooring, custom steel handrails, and heavy glass shower enclosures are the kind of details that make this home feel like more than the price tag suggests. Both bedrooms are upstairs, along with a full guest bath: a great layout for roommates, a home office setup, or just keeping living and sleeping spaces separate. The primary suite includes an ensuite bath with walk-in closet. A powder room on the main floor adds everyday convenience. Slip out the back to a private yard, or pull into your attached side-entry carport. Rinnai instant hot water, 50-year smart siding, smart thermostats, and low electric bills mean the home works as well as it looks. Central Austin. Easy living. Move-in ready.
